Company Overview:

GreenPower Motor Company Inc. (GreenPower) stands at the forefront of manufacturing and distributing specialized, all-electric, zero-emission medium and heavy-duty vehicles tailored for the cargo and delivery sector, shuttle and transit industry, as well as the school bus market.

Position Summary:

The Electrical Assembly Technician is responsible for the assembly and installation of components and materials according to detailed work instructions and verbal guidance.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Assemble and install drive train, mechanical, and chassis components in accordance with specified work instructions.
  • Possess knowledge of truck air systems, including airline routing, air bags, brake valves, and leveling valves.
  • Adhere to both verbal and written directives for task completion.
  • Verify the proper functionality of all assembled components and systems.
  • Identify and assist in resolving issues stemming from engineering or design discrepancies.
  • Engage in continuous self-assessment during shifts, proposing enhancements for operational efficiency.
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e workspace while optimizing the use of available space.
  • Collaborate effectively with supervisors and colleagues.
  • Operate and perform preventive maintenance on warehouse vehicles and equipment.
  • Comply with quality service standards and adhere to established procedures, rules, and regulations.
